Federal Employee Gets Fired After Writing An Article Criticizing Nukes
August 3rd, 2014Via: io9: For 17 years, James Doyle was a nuclear policy specialist at the Los Alamos National Laboratory. Then he wrote an article that made the case for getting rid of nuclear weapons. After that, his computer was seized, he was accused of releasing classified information, and then he was fired.

U.S. Can’t Account for 40% of Firearms Sent to Afghan Security Forces
July 28th, 2014Via: Washington Times: A government oversight agency says the Pentagon has lost track of more than 40 percent of the $626 million in firearms it has provided to Afghanistan’s security forces, prompting officials to contemplate a “carrot and stick” approach to arming the fledgling military.
